But what is esports  exactly? In a nutshell, it is competitive online video gaming with professional players, organized leagues and tournaments, and a dedicated fan base. The genres of esports vary, but they are mostly team-based games such as multiplayer online battle arenas (where a team of gamers fight against each other), real-time strategy (where a player takes control of an entire army to conquer a territory), and first-person shooter games (where a player controls a character in a virtual world to defeat opponents).

Esports have achieved such monumental growth because of their deep engagement rates and dedicated fan bases, with audiences spending an average of 100 minutes watching their favorite teams play. They are also able to generate high revenues through sponsorship deals, prize pools from tournament wins, merchandise sales, and more. But it’s not all sunshine and roses in the esports world: controversies such as sexual harassment, gender discrimination, and toxic culture have popped up in recent years, forcing developers to make positive changes.
